#4263c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4263cb is composed of 25.9% red, 38.8%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 225.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 52.7%. #4263cb color hex could be obtained by blending #84c6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#4263cb color description : Moderate blue.
#4263c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4263cb has RGB values of R:66, G:99,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4350923.

Shades and Tints of #4263c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050b is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4263cb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83858a is the less saturated color, while #144bf9 is the most saturated one.
